Miss Diane Day, front, was hostess last weekend to six friends from Wichita Falls. Top left are Tom Arnhold, top right, Dick Waggoner, center left, Drucilla Spain, center right, Bob Vinson, lower left, Marilyn Wheeler, and lower right, Nancy Penix. The visitors were here on Friday to attend the Junior Canwick Club dance and a breakfast Saturday at the home of Miss Day's parents. Mr. and Mrs. J. Warren Day. Published in Fort Worth Star-Telegram morning edition April 24, 1954.
